Gravina steps down as president of Italian football federation

Gabriele Gravina has resigned as president of the Italian Federation following Italy’s failure to qualify for the World Cup, according to Romano’s latest report.

Gravina had served as the top official of the Italian football association since October 2018. During his tenure, the Nazionale won Euro 2020 but failed to qualify for the 2022 and 2026 World Cups. Italy had also missed the 2018 World Cup before Gravina’s appointment.

He oversaw the appointments of Luciano Spalletti and Gennaro Gattuso as head coaches in 2023 and 2025, respectively.

Gravina’s resignation comes amid growing criticism over Italy’s repeated World Cup failures, marking a significant turning point for Italian football leadership.
